## Overview The **10K RM065** is a high-precision resistor ideal for various electronic applications. Designed for durability and reliability, this resistor offers exceptional performance in both professional and hobbyist settings. Its robust construction ensures consistent resistance over time, making it a staple component for any electronic toolkit. ## Key Features - **High Precision**: Offers a resistance value of 10k ohms, perfect for precision circuits. - **Durability**: Built to withstand high temperatures and heavy usage. - **Compact Design**: Small form factor that fits easily into any circuit board. ## Technical Specifications - **Resistance**: 10k ohms - **Tolerance**: ±5% - **Power Rating**: 0.25W - **Temperature Coefficient**: ±100 ppm/°C ## Applications The 10K RM065 is versatile, suitable for a wide range of applications including: - **Circuit Prototyping** - **Signal Processing** - **Voltage Divider Networks** ## Benefits This resistor provides **consistent performance** and **long-lasting reliability**.
